Practice areas
Structexa operates as a U.S.-based professional engineering consultancy — discipline-led practice groups delivering stamped plans, technical calculations, and agency-ready submittals for private developers, contractors, institutions, and public agencies.
CE
Practice 01
Site development, grading, utilities, and stormwater management for subdivisions, commercial, and public projects — permit‑ready civil engineering from entitlement through construction issuance.
SE
Practice 02
Structural design and analysis for wood, steel, and concrete buildings — gravity and lateral systems per IBC and ASCE 7, with PE‑stamped calculations and construction documents for permit submittal.
A&E
Practice 03
Architectural design from schematic through permit-ready plans — coordinated with structural and MEP engineering to produce constructible, code-compliant documentation.
MEP
Practice 04
Mechanical, electrical, and plumbing engineering — load development, distribution design, and energy compliance (Title 24 where applicable), fully coordinated with architectural and structural drawings.
HVAC
Practice 05
Dedicated heating, ventilation, and air-conditioning design — load calculations, equipment selection, and distribution systems per IMC and applicable energy standards.
